From 03d65dd99ba593d2dab1a8151fa7766b650755ac Mon Sep 17 00:00:00 2001 From: Alexandre Oliva Date: Wed, 9 Jul 2003 17:52:31 +0000 Subject: * libc/include/math.h (nan, nanf): Update prototype to C99. * libm/common/s_nan.c (nan): Likewise. * libm/common/s_nanf.c (nanf, nan): Likewise. * libc/sys/linux/cmath/math_private.h (nan, nanf): Likewise. --- newlib/libm/common/s_nan.c | 9 +++++---- newlib/libm/common/sf_nan.c | 6 +++--- 2 files changed, 8 insertions(+), 7 deletions(-) (limited to 'newlib/libm') diff --git a/newlib/libm/common/s_nan.c b/newlib/libm/common/s_nan.c index f06242647..a7d4dadf8 100644 --- a/newlib/libm/common/s_nan.c +++ b/newlib/libm/common/s_nan.c @@ -14,8 +14,8 @@ INDEX ANSI_SYNOPSIS #include - double nan(void); - float nanf(void); + double nan(const char *); + float nanf(const char *); TRAD_SYNOPSIS #include @@ -25,7 +25,8 @@ TRAD_SYNOPSIS DESCRIPTION <> and <> return an IEEE NaN (Not a Number) in - double and single precision arithmetic respectivly. + double and single precision arithmetic respectivly. The + argument is currently disregarded. QUICKREF nan - pure @@ -36,7 +37,7 @@ QUICKREF #ifndef _DOUBLE_IS_32BITS - double nan() + double nan(const char *unused) { double x; diff --git a/newlib/libm/common/sf_nan.c b/newlib/libm/common/sf_nan.c index c8d7027f8..831f3f79f 100644 --- a/newlib/libm/common/sf_nan.c +++ b/newlib/libm/common/sf_nan.c @@ -5,7 +5,7 @@ #include "fdlibm.h" - float nanf() + float nanf(const char *unused) { float x; @@ -15,9 +15,9 @@ #ifdef _DOUBLE_IS_32BITS - double nan() + double nan(const char *arg) { - return (double) nanf(); + return (double) nanf(arg); } #endif /* defined(_DOUBLE_IS_32BITS) */ -- cgit v1.2.3